Posted: Saturday, June 02, 2018 - 07:34 PM UTC
Light at the end of the Aluminum tunnel. For now.
It looks better than last time I took a photo. The end caps for the chassis might be aluminum or might be red. I think they will stay aluminum.
The front of those pieces will be red.
Here is the cockpit with the floor, fire extinguisher, and front lower suspension arms dry-fitted in place. Some touch-up with aluminum still needs to be done, but it is looking better than before. The A lot of it won't be seen as the driver's seat will cover it.
I have also been painting the brake drums and rear suspension parts. And also filling ejector pin marks on the front and rear wings.

Posted: Thursday, September 06, 2018 - 11:00 PM UTC
Damian: The chrome is AK-interactive, over Ak's gloss black base coat. Next time around I will try Tamiya gloss black, as base coat, to see if I can get an even better sheen. Ak's dries semi-gloss.
